Bedford residents attending the Strawberry Festival will have an opportunity to take part in a special patriotic observance as part of the city’s America 250 celebration.

A Flag Retirement Ceremony is scheduled for Sunday, June 14, from 3:00 to 3:30 p.m. at Bedford Commons. The ceremony will be conducted by local Scout Pack 699 and Troop 233.

According to the City of Bedford’s America 250 Commemorative Event Guide, the scouts will carry out the time-honored tradition of retiring American flags with dignity and respect. The ceremony will take place during the Strawberry Festival and is one of several events planned as part of Bedford’s participation in the America 250 celebration.

The City of Bedford has joined the America 250-Ohio Commission in recognizing the nation’s upcoming 250th anniversary in 2026 and has planned a variety of events throughout the year highlighting America’s history and Ohio’s contributions to the nation.
